Step-by-step explanation:
<u>Step 1: Define</u>
-84 = -2(2 + 5k)
<u>Step 2: Solve for </u><em><u>k</u></em>
- Divide -2 on both sides: 42 = 2 + 5k
- Isolate <em>k</em> term: 40 = 5k
- Isolate <em>k</em>: 8 = k
- Rewrite: k = 8
<u>Step 3: Check</u>
<em>Plug in k into the original equation to verify it's a solution.</em>
- Substitute in <em>k</em>: -84 = -2(2 + 5(8))
- Multiply: -84 = -2(2 + 40)
- Add: -84 = -2(42)
- Multiply: -84 = -84
Here we see that -84 does indeed equal -84.
∴ k = 8 is the solution to the equation.
